The tenth definitive issue of USSR stamps was put into circulation from January 1, 1961 to August 1966. In January 1961, in connection with the monetary reform, stamps of the tenth definitive issue entered circulation under a new price scale. Initially, the series consisted of seven denominations. For the first time on definitive stamps, the year of issue was indicated.
In the miniature, artist Vasily Zavyalov depicted a combine operator at the controls. In 1958, Vasily Zavyalov was nominated for the title “Honored Artist of the RSFSR”; however, because of an error on the stamp “Meeting of Ministers of Communications of Socialist Countries in Moscow” (the colors of the Czechoslovak flag were reversed), the title was not awarded to him. Vasily Vasilyevich received the title of Honored Artist of the RSFSR only ten years later. He is buried at Danilovskoye Cemetery, plot 36, in a family grave.
